Skocz do zawartości

[ODRZUCONE]Podanie na AMXX Support "PaPeK" Spróbować można


★ PaPeK ★

Rekomendowane odpowiedzi

Nick:  ★ PaPeK  ★

Wiek: 22

Znajomość AMXX (x/10): 10

Staż na forum: od 20 września

Dlaczego chcesz pełnić tę funkcję?: Posiadałem ponad 12 serwerów cs 1.6 postawionych od zera przeze mnie.Edytuje pluginy , piszę w małym stopniu , chciałbym pomóc @klqs, ponieważ jest z tym wszystkim sam, oraz chciałbym pomóc  wszystkim, którzy mają problem lub błąd z pluginami.

Kontakt: GG: 60971922 , Forum , TS3 , nr telefonu jeśli będzie trzeba :) 

 

@LOLSON 

Plugin:

 

// AMXX armor by "PaPeK"


#include <amxmodx>
#include <amxmisc>
#include <cstrike>

#define PLUGIN "Kupowanie Armora"
#define VERSION "1.0"
#define AUTHOR "PaPeK"

new cost
new armor_amount

public plugin_init() {
    register_plugin(PLUGIN, VERSION, AUTHOR)
    register_clcmd("say /armor","armor")
    register_clcmd("say /armorcost","armor_cost")
    armor_amount = register_cvar("amx_armor","200")
    cost = register_cvar("amx_armor_cost","5000")
        
    register_dictionary("kup_armor.txt")
    
    register_event("HLTV", "hltv_event", "a", "1=0", "2=0")  
    
}
public armor(id)
{
    if(!is_user_alive(id))
    {
        client_print(id,print_center,"%L",LANG_PLAYER,"MUST_BE_ALIVE")
        return PLUGIN_HANDLED
    }
    
    if(cs_get_user_money(id) < get_pcvar_num(cost))
    {
        client_print(id,print_center,"%L",LANG_PLAYER,"MORE_MONEY")
        return PLUGIN_HANDLED
    }
    
    if(get_user_armor(id) >= get_pcvar_num(armor_amount))
    {
        client_print(id,print_center,"%L",LANG_PLAYER,"ONLY_ONE")
        return PLUGIN_HANDLED
    }    
    
    cs_set_user_money(id,cs_get_user_money(id) - get_pcvar_num(armor_amount))
    cs_set_user_armor(id,get_pcvar_num(armor_amount),CS_ARMOR_VESTHELM)
    client_print(id,print_center,"%L",LANG_PLAYER,"YOU_GET_ARMOR",get_cvar_num("amx_armor"))    
    
    return PLUGIN_HANDLED
}


public hltv_event()
{
    client_print(0,print_chat,"%L",LANG_PLAYER,"AD")
}

public armor_cost(id)
{    
    client_print(id,print_chat,"%L",LANG_PLAYER,"COST",get_pcvar_num(armor_amount),get_pcvar_num(cost))
}

Edytowane przez ★ PaPeK ★
Dopisany plugin myślę że prosty 3 biblioteki wymagane nic specjalnego.Zwykłe kupowanie armora przez komendę na say.
Odnośnik do komentarza
Udostępnij na innych stronach

Gość
Ten temat został zamknięty. Brak możliwości dodania odpowiedzi.
×
×
  • Dodaj nową pozycję...